But whale bone offered some advantages, including its large dimensions, with some of the projectile points measuring more than 16 inches (40 cm) long, a size difficult to achieve using antler.
Analysis of 20,000-year-old bone tools from Spain demonstrates that humans used whale remains from at least five large species, including sperm, fin, blue, and gray whales, for toolmaking.
